What the major differences between sectors, apart from the obvious difference in ships?

Do some sectors contain more shops? I once found four in a civilian sector. I tend to avoid nebula sectors, as they seem to have less shops.

Methinks the rebel fleet flies a little slower in nebula sectors overall, and sensors are off, plus the different possible events. But the biggest difference comes from the ships you might encounter, at progressively higher difficulty.

Char;y wrote:What the major differences between sectors, apart from the obvious difference in ships?
Every beacon has one "event" tied to it. The even may be a shop, a quest, an enemy ship, nothing - you get the idea. Now, every type of sector has different list from which events are randomly chosen
Char;y wrote:Do some sectors contain more shops? I once found four in a civilian sector. I tend to avoid nebula sectors, as they seem to have less shops.
I'm now looking into data.dat, It seem you're right: "Uncharted Nebula" should have 1 or 2 stores, however "Slug Home Nebula" and "Slug Controlled Nebula" should have 2 to 3 shops, just like "Engi Controlled Sector". Mantis sectors also have 1-2 shops, so it seems number of shops is more related to how hostile the sector is, not is it clear or nebula.
